Bulletin of The Korean Mathematical Society | 2010
Madjid Eshaghi Gordji
In this paper, we obtain the general solution and the generalized Hyers-Ulam Rassias stability of the functional equation f(2x + y) + f(2x - y) = 4(f(x + y) + f(x - y)) - (f(2y) - 2f(y)) + 2f(2x) - 8f(x).
Mathematical and Computer Modelling | 2011
Madjid Eshaghi Gordji; Hamid Baghani; Yeol Je Cho
Abstract Following the definition of coupled fixed point [T. G. Bhaskar, V. Lakshmikantham, Fixed point theorems in partially ordered metric spaces and applications, Nonlinear Anal. 65 (2006) 1379–1393], we prove a coupled fixed point theorem for contractive mappings in partially complete intuitionistic fuzzy normed spaces.
Fixed Point Theory and Applications | 2012
Madjid Eshaghi Gordji; Maryam Ramezani; Yeol Je Cho; Saeideh Pirbavafa
The purpose of this article is to present some fixed point theorems for generalized contraction in partially ordered complete metric spaces. As an application, we give an existence and uniqueness for the solution of an initial-boundary-value problem.2000 Mathematics Subject Classification: 47H10; 54H25; 34B15.
Proceedings of the National Academy of Sciences of the United States of America | 2011
Ali Ebadian; Ismail Nikoufar; Madjid Eshaghi Gordji
In this paper, we generalize the main results of [Effros EG, (2009) Proc Natl Acad. Sci USA 106:1006–1008]. Namely, we provide the necessary and sufficient conditions for jointly convexity of perspective functions and generalized perspective functions.
Journal of Inequalities and Applications | 2011
Abasalt Bodaghi; Idham Arif Alias; Madjid Eshaghi Gordji
We prove the superstability of quadratic double centralizers and of quadratic multipliers on Banach algebras by fixed point methods. These results show that we can remove the conditions of being weakly commutative and weakly without order which are used in the work of M. E. Gordji et al. (2011) for Banach algebras.
Journal of Inequalities and Applications | 2014
Abdul Latif; Madjid Eshaghi Gordji; Erdal Karapınar; Wutiphol Sintunavarat
In this paper, we introduce a new type of a generalized-(α,ψ)-Meir-Keeler contractive mapping and establish some interesting theorems on the existence of fixed points for such mappings via admissible mappings. Applying our results, we derive fixed point theorems in ordinary metric spaces and metric spaces endowed with an arbitrary binary relation.MSC:47H10, 54H25.
Fixed Point Theory and Applications | 2012
Madjid Eshaghi Gordji; Esmat Akbartabar; Yeol Je Cho; Maryam Ramezani
In this paper, we introduce the concept of a mixed weakly monotone pair of mappings and prove some coupled common fixed point theorems for a contractive-type mappings with the mixed weakly monotone property in partially ordered metric spaces. Our results are generalizations of the main results of Bhaskar and Lakshmikantham and Kadelburg et al.Mathematics Subject Classification 2000: 54H25.
Fixed Point Theory and Applications | 2013
Mohadeseh Paknazar; Madjid Eshaghi Gordji; Manuel de la Sen; Seyed Mansour Vaezpour
In present paper we introduce the concept of a new g-monotone mapping and define the notions of n-fixed point and n-coincidence point and prove some related theorems for nonlinear contractive mappings in partially ordered complete metric spaces. Our results are generalization of the main results of Lakshmikantham and Ćirić (Nonlinear Anal. 70:4341-4349, 2009) and include several recent developments. Moreover, we give an example to support our results.MSC:Primary 47H10; secondary 54H25; 34B15.
Fixed Point Theory and Applications | 2012
Madjid Eshaghi Gordji; Hamid Baghani; Gwang Hui Kim
The purpose of this article is to present some fixed point theorems for (ψ, φ)-weak contractive mappings in a complete metric space endowed with a partial order. As an application of the main result, we give an existence theorem for the solution of a periodic boundary value problem.2000 Mathematics Subject Classification: 47H10.
